I'm planning to purchase an Apple TV to experiment with connecting my iPad wirelessly to my projector so I can move about a room. I use my iPad connected to my projector in almost every class I teach and having the iPad tethered to a projector by a cable is often awkward.
Does the projector have an hdmi connection? then you jist need to hook up apple tv to projector and thenyou can wirelessly project from ipad to apple tv to monitor. look for the airplay symbol next to videos, websites,documents. very easy to do. no need to tether with a cable. if no hdmi connection to monitor, you will need adapter. hdmi to vga.
